Agricultural Training Centre, Kumasi, Gold Coast [i.e. Ghana], 1946 - 1954

 Sub-Series
Reference Code: GBR/0115/RCS/Y304E/185-186
Scope and Contents British Official photographs.Junior officers for the Gold Coast Department of Agriculture receive their training at the Kumasi Agricultural Centre. Staffed by an agricultural officer and two assistants, the centre provides a three year course. Young men from the secondary schools spend a first year in the Training Centre, a second year on field work and a third year at the Centre. They are taught agricultural principles about the cultivation of the soil and the maintenance of soil...

Alan Rudwick collection

 Fonds
Reference Code: GBR/0115/RCS/Y30448J
Scope and Contents Loose photographs taken by Alan Rudwick unless otherwise indicated. All photographs are 215 x 165 mm unless otherwise stated. They fall into two groups; photographs of trade castles (1-28) and other views, chiefly of Achimota. Along the West Africa coast are the remains of more than 40 castles and fortified posts set up by European nations engaged in commerce, including the Transatlantic slave trade, with West Africa, the greatest concentration being in what became the Gold Coast, now...

Anamabo Fort, Gold Coast [i.e. Ghana], 1924

 Item
Reference Code: GBR/0115/RCS/PC Gold Coast/23
Scope and Contents

The caption on the reverse reads: 'Anamabo Fort, Gold Coast. A seventeenth century fort, built by 'The Royal African Company' and lying some twelve miles east of Cape Coast Castle. It was heavily besieged by the Ashanti armies that overran the country in about 1825'.

Ancient Briton, 1917

 Item
Reference Code: GBR/0115/RCS/Y30448L/4
Scope and Contents

150 x 200 mm. One of the Red Cross Tableaux 1917. Identified in a contemporary hand as Mr Bettington. Digby Rowland Albemarle Bettington (b. 1879) served in the South African and Great Wars. After police posts in Cyprus and Sierra Leone, he was appointed Deputy Commissioner of Police, Gold Coast, in 1910 and promoted to Inspector-General in 1917. See also Y30448L/66.

Ancient West African, 1917

 Item
Reference Code: GBR/0115/RCS/Y30448L/1
Scope and Contents 150 x 200 mm. One of the items in the Tableaux arranged in aid of the Red Cross by Lady Clifford in 1917. Her efforts for the Red Cross in 1917 also included a procession of over 3,000 costumed children, and a gymkhana meeting. In 1918 she edited a book ‘Our Days on the Gold Coast’ containing essays on the events of one day submitted by a wide variety of the Colony's inhabitants, and published in aid of the Red Cross.
